Scope and Content Rubbing titled on reverse: 'In Tunnel thro' the Rock close to "Court" Cave. East Wemyss, Fife. April 27/66'. The date on this rubbing is after James Young Simpson's lecture to the Society of Antiquaries of Scotland in January 1866. The identity of the creator of the rubbing is uncertain.
